Introduction As an experienced tutor registered on UrbanPro.com specializing in Agile Training, I can provide valuable insights into the key aspects of Agile methodology and its measurement. Understanding Agile Methodology Agile methodology is a project management and product development approach that prioritizes flexibility, collaboration, and customer satisfaction. It is used to manage and adapt to change in a rapidly evolving environment. Key Principles of Agile Methodology Iterative Development: Agile emphasizes breaking down the project into small, manageable iterations or sprints. Each iteration delivers a potentially shippable product increment. Customer Collaboration: Continuous involvement of stakeholders and customers throughout the development process. Regular feedback and adjustments based on customer input. Adaptability: Agile is designed to respond to change quickly and efficiently. It prioritizes individuals and interactions over processes and tools. Agile Methodology Measurement Agile methodology is used to measure various aspects of the development process to ensure continuous improvement and project success. Velocity: Measures the amount of work completed in each iteration. Helps in predicting how much work the team can accomplish in future sprints. Burndown Charts: Visual representation of work completed versus the work remaining. Aids in tracking progress and identifying potential issues. Cycle Time: Measures the time taken to complete a task from start to finish. Useful for identifying bottlenecks and optimizing workflow. Lead Time: Measures the time from the initiation of a task to its completion. Helps in understanding the overall efficiency of the development process.
